There are many different plans available today in the US. And low cost health insurance is definitely available - if you know where and how to find it. Health insurance is simply the coverage of medical claims of an individual, against the medical costs.
Many people don't realize that people without health insurance have bad teeth because, if you're paying for everything out of your own pocket, going to the dentist for an exam seems like a luxury. It's important to know what you need to look for in a good plan, so when you're looking for cheaper insurance, you want the lowest cost per year that will fit into your budget of course.
Buying insurance online is one way to save money because the insurance company saves money because they don't have to pay an agent a commission; this could mean as much as 10% to 15% savings for you. You can charge your payments to a credit card for online insurance which means you probably aren't going to forget about a payment and ever be without insurance and still gives you another 30 days before you actually need to pay. Although it increases your risk, one way to lower your costs is to ask for a higher deductible; if you're in good health you'll more than likely come out ahead, barring the unforeseen accident etc.
One big advantage of buying health insurance online is you can easily change your coverage, deductibles, or payment options with just a few clicks of the mouse rather than going through any paperwork delay with a local agent. In case your doctor decides that something is a medical necessity and it's not covered under your current plan, the insurance company may exercise its discretion in paying for it, but don't hold your breath. And heart-attack victims who don't have insurance are less likely to receive angioplasty. You want to avoid having to face a $100,000 open heart surgery without any health insurance at all.
Your local agents may only be able to offer what they have available to them and not be able to offer you what's best for you both financially and health-wise. And, of course, every other country in the industrialized world insures its citizens; despite the extra hundreds of billions of dollars we spend each year, we leave forty-five million people without any insurance at all.
Also there are several providers that offer cheap health insurance with low cost premiums for single people. People who have pneumonia and don't have insurance are less likely to receive x-rays or consultations. One of the most important things to remember is that finding low cost health insurance is realizing that the main purpose of any insurance policy is to protect you from major medical financial losses, not to protect you from spending small amounts of money on doctor visits.
Online agents can help you submit any insurance claims necessary; you don't need a local agent. Another way to lower your cost is to eliminate any coverage that you'll not likely need such as maternity coverage.
Another way you might look for low cost insurance is to ask your doctor for suggestions. Cheap or low cost health insurance does mean a lower price and in some cases a lower quality, but the price may be more important to some people than the quality of the health plan.
To sum up: for people without pre-existing conditions or other complicating factors, a simple health insurance plan with a high deductible may be appropriate. There are many options online. Finding the best plan does not simply mean looking for the lowest premium but it means fully understanding all of the costs that are involved in your policy. So taking out insurance with higher deductibles and spending a little time online comparing quotes from at least five or more companies, will help you find the best low cost health insurance.
